In a horrific incident, at least 6 stray dogs were reportedly poisoned to death by a woman in Jagruti Vihar In Burla, Sambalpur on May 28th. A complaint in connection with the matter was lodged by animal welfare organisation People For Animals (PFA) at the Burla Police Station on Wednesday. The accused woman identified as Sushri Sangeeta Biswal reportedly poisoned the dogs as they had damaged her vehicle. As per reports, an investigation into the matter is underway. Meanwhile, Chairperson of the People For Animals (PFA), Maneka Gandhi spoke to the Sambalpur SP requesting appropriate action against the culprit.
